A healthcare charity is looking for a Strategic Senior Buyer to manage Orthopaedics procurement. The role requires strategic sourcing expertise and strong communication skills, ensuring cost-effective sourcing and supplier relationship management. The ideal candidate will have relevant experience in healthcare procurement and MCIPS qualification.

As a Strategic Senior Buyer, you'll bring experience of working closely with internal stakeholders to ensure a successful commercial outcome, a basic knowledge of contract law and experience of working within cross functional unit teams to deliver procurement projects. You will have first-class communication skills, a strategic sourcing and category management expertise and be commercially focused with a proven ability of considering total cost of ownership and delivering added value. You\'ll be responsible for ensuring products and services are competitively sourced and cost effective as well as maintaining supplier relationships from a commercial perspective, controlling costs, quality, ongoing service enhancements and risk management.
